Romario de Souza Faria Filho (born 20 September 1993), commonly known as Romarinho, is a Brazilian footballer who plays for Zweigen Kanazawa as a forward.

Club career
Born in Barcelona, Catalonia, Romarinho joined Vasco da Gama's youth setup in 2007. On 5 December 2012, he rescinded with the club, and moved to Brasiliense a day later.
Romarinho made his senior debuts during the 2013 campaign, scoring a goal in the year's Campeonato Brasiliense 3–0 win over Brasilia. On 5 January 2015 he left Brasiliense, and immediately returned to his first club Vasco.
Romarinho made his Serie A debut on 29 August 2015, coming on as a late substitute for Julio dos Santos in a 0–1 home loss against Figueirense.
Personal life
Romarinho's father, Romario, was also a footballer and a forward. He too was groomed at Vasco.
